How to Bleach Decks
- 1). Hose off the deck to remove the bulk of surface dirt, dust, pollen and other grime. Use a pressure nozzle on the hose to put out a forceful stream. There is no need to use a pressure washer, unless desired.
- 2). Spray on a wood cleaner if you have stubborn dirt or stains that need to be removed. Use a long-handled scrub brush to work it in and clean the wood.
- 3). Fill a bucket with 1 part bleach and 9 parts water. Mix together. This is the recommended proportion for a bleach cleaner to kill mold. Fill the mixture into a garden or chemical sprayer.
- 4). Spray the deck in its entirety. Soak the wood so there is enough to seep down into every crevice and the wood itself. Allow it to sit for several minutes.
- 5). Hose down the deck again to rinse off the bleach solution.
